### Capacity note: Lattice UI library versioning

Each minor release of the Lattice component library triggers rebuilds across roughly forty consumer apps, and our registry mirrors must hold every supported version plus two deprecated lines. Storage growth is dominated by icon bundles, so pruning cadence matters more than raw quota. Before we approve the proposed monthly release train, we should agree on retention and concurrency settings. The constants we're currently running are listed below.

tuning table, yajog-yahof:
BUDGETS = {
    "lamvan": 303,
    "wenox": 460,
    "fenvan": 525,
}

Subject: Queue-depth autoscaler going out today

Hey all — quick heads-up for folks new to the Bramblewick team: the queue-depth autoscaler ships in this afternoon's release. It scales workers off backlog size instead of CPU, so expect pod counts to look jumpier than usual. That's normal. Ping the release channel if anything looks truly weird. The build token for this rollout is right below.

trace token, tawep-fahif: htk3_b58

## Service Accounts: TilePuffin Prefetcher

Quick refresher for release cuts: TilePuffin is the map-tile prefetcher that warms the cache for the Varnholt region packs before each release goes live. It runs under the `svc-tilepuffin` account, which only has read access to the tile store and write access to the warm-cache bucket. Don't reuse this account for anything else, please — we've been burned before. When you trigger the prefetch job manually, authenticate against the Lanternway gateway using the key below.

service key, tahaf-yaduf: qvz11-icGvt2med8u

## Data Stores — Nightly Reindex

Hey plugin folks: every night around 02:00 the Lanternsearch reindexer rebuilds the full-text index from the canonical docs store. Your plugins shouldn't write during the rebuild window — queue mutations and they'll flush after. Custom analyzers get picked up automatically if registered before midnight. If you need to inspect reindex progress or analyzer registration, the job state lives in the coordination database, available via the connection string below.

replica DSN, kajep-yahag: mssql://praok_svc:iF@db-8d68.plorvaio.local:5432/eliion